Subarashii Kudamono gourmet Asian pears are exquisite examples of this long-celebrated delicacy. Though called by many names (pear-apple, sand pear, nashi) the Asian pear is a true pear with a character so unique it was, for centuries, a luxury food of royalty and nobility.

Spring Mushroom and Edible Hunt

Hike through the lush, private forest of the Pocono Manor’s 3,000 acre estate foraging for spring mushrooms and other wild edibles. Participants will be lead by renowned mushroom appreciator and hunter Bill Russell, author of Field Guide to Wild Mushrooms of Pennsylvania and the Mid-Atlan...tic. Hunters will learn about wild edibles growing in this unique environment and perhaps, if they are lucky stumble upon some clusters of morels (which will be in the height of their growing season). Hikers will then present their finds to Chef Doug Becker from Pocono Manor’s The Exchange, who will incorporate the gathered ingredients into a gourmet feast prepared in the open air. Lunch will include wine pairings to compliment the earthy flavors of the gathered wild mushrooms.
